De-SO2, De-NOx

Desulfurization (DeSO2) systems are used for removing SO2 (Sulphur Dioxide), acid gases, heavy metals, particulates & other air pollutants from plant emissions.

Rationale

All Thermal Power Plants are required to comply with the emission norms as notified by the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change (MoEF&CC) and directions given by Central Pollution Control Board (CPCB) from time to time. In December 2015, the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change (MoEFCC)issued revised emission norms for particulate matter (PM), sulphur dioxide (SO2), and oxides of nitrogen for TPPs.

Brief About the Works being carried out

Considering NTPC’s commitments toward sustainable practices to produce power with minimum emissions, NTPC has taken various measures to control undesirable emissions into the environment. For SO2 emission reduction, FGD technology is currently at various stages of implementation for approx. 65 GW capacity. On the same line, NOx control through combustion modification/ optimization and Installation of ESP system for SPM control has already been implemented or being implemented in almost all units of NTPC.
